Revolutionizing Liquid Measurement: The Advantages of Non-contact Radar Water Level Sensors

Non-contact radar water level sensors represent a significant advancement in the field of liquid measurement technology. These sensors utilize radar waves to gauge the level of liquid in a tank or body of water without the need for physical contact with the liquid itself. This technology offers several advantages, making it an attractive option for various applications across multiple industries.
One of the main benefits of non-contact radar water level sensors is their high accuracy. Unlike traditional sensors that may be affected by dust, condensation, or other environmental conditions, radar sensors operate effectively in challenging environments. They can provide precise readings regardless of the temperature, pressure, or vapor presence, making them ideal for diverse settings such as wastewater treatment plants, chemical storage, and even in harsh outdoor conditions.
Additionally, non-contact radar sensors require minimal maintenance compared to their contact counterparts. Since these sensors do not come into direct contact with the liquid, there is a lower risk of clogging or corrosion, leading to longer service life and reduced operational costs. This characteristic is particularly advantageous in applications where ongoing maintenance could be challenging or costly, thus contributing to overall efficiency.
The versatility of non-contact radar water level sensors extends to their ability to measure a wide range of liquids, including those that are corrosive, viscous, or volatile. This flexibility makes them suitable for various industries, including agriculture, oil and gas, and food and beverage, where the properties of the liquids being measured can vary significantly.
Moreover, the installation of non-contact radar sensors is generally straightforward and can often be integrated into existing systems without extensive modifications. This ease of installation not only saves time but also reduces labor costs, enabling organizations to adopt this advanced technology with minimal disruption to their operations.
Another important feature of non-contact radar water level sensors is their ability to transmit data over long distances. Many modern sensors offer wireless connectivity options, allowing for real-time monitoring and data collection. These capabilities facilitate better decision-making and enhance operational efficiency, as users can access crucial information from remote locations.
In conclusion, non-contact radar water level sensors are transforming the way industries measure liquid levels. Their accuracy, low maintenance requirements, versatility, ease of installation, and wireless capabilities make them an attractive option for businesses looking to improve their liquid measurement processes. As technology continues to evolve, these sensors are likely to play an increasingly critical role in various sectors, ensuring safety, efficiency, and reliability.
